Understanding the Ky-008 Datasheet and Its Applications
The Ky-008 Datasheet provides a comprehensive overview of the Ky-008 module, which is typically an infrared (IR) emitting diode module. This means it's designed to send out invisible infrared light. The datasheet details its electrical characteristics, operational parameters, and pin configurations. This information is vital for ensuring the module functions correctly and safely within your electronic circuits. It helps you understand how much power it needs, what voltage levels it operates at, and how to connect it to your microcontroller or other electronic components.
The information found within the Ky-008 Datasheet is used in several key ways:
- Circuit Design: Engineers and hobbyists use the datasheet to determine the appropriate resistors, capacitors, and other components needed to build a stable and functional circuit around the Ky-008.
- Compatibility Checks: It clarifies the module's voltage and current requirements, ensuring it's compatible with the chosen microcontroller (like an Arduino) or power supply.
- Performance Expectations: The datasheet outlines the expected range and intensity of the infrared emission, helping users set realistic performance goals for their projects.
Here’s a simplified look at some typical specifications you might find:
| Parameter | Typical Value |
|---|---|
| Operating Voltage | 3.3V - 5V |
| Emitting Wavelength | ~940nm (Infrared) |
| Current Consumption | ~20mA |
